Step 6: Configure the load generator against the Wrenmarket checkout flow. Point hammerline at the staging storefront only — never production — and confirm the target host in loadtest.env before anything else. Set concurrency to 50 virtual shoppers for the first pass; the Orchard Gate payment sandbox throttles beyond that. The sandbox requires an API secret so synthetic transactions are accepted rather than flagged as fraud. Add that secret on the line immediately after this one.

sealed setting: ARCHIVE_KEY3=8d0

The Pairwell matching service occasionally hits long garbage-collection pauses during reindexing, so signed artifacts include a GC tuning profile. Plugin authors must not override heap flags; the profile is validated at load time against the signed manifest. Unsigned or tampered artifacts are refused by the Quillbrook loader. Before publishing, sign your artifact bundle with the distribution key. The key designated for external plugin artifact signing is as follows.

release key, kawif-hawep: bky13_X7TGuRG4Zu4ZJ

/*
 * Hot-reload configuration for the Brindlewood config watcher.
 *
 * These constants govern how quickly the watcher picks up changes
 * to on-disk config and how aggressively it debounces rapid edits.
 * Note for release managers: the reload path bypasses the normal
 * deploy pipeline, so overly short intervals can apply half-written
 * files mid-rollout. Values were validated during the Oakhurst
 * staging soak and should not be changed without a fresh soak run.
 * The current production-approved constants are defined below:
 */

tuning table, yajog-yahof:
BUDGETS = {
    "lamvan": 303,
    "wenox": 460,
    "fenvan": 525,
}

Team, the postmortem for the stale-cache bug in the Ferndale checkout service is attached. Root cause: the Opaline invalidation worker silently dropped purge events during the failover. On-call: please verify the replay queue drained before closing the incident. The patched build that restores purge acknowledgements is identified below.

pipeline stamp: htk14_378fd70323001d